Who is Elizabeth Bradley?

Elizabeth Bradley is an American professor, originally from Canada. She was the head of drama at Carnegie Mellon University, and since June 1, 2008 has worked as Chair of the Department of Drama at New York University's Tisch School of the Arts as part of a three-year appointment in that position. She earned a BFA degree in theatre from York University in Toronto and has produced several acclaimed stage shows. She has also worked as a programming consultant for the National Arts Centre in Ottawa, as general manager and CEO of the Hummingbird Centre and as director of communications and special projects at the Stratford Festival.

She was the founding artistic director of the Pittsburgh International Festival of Firsts in 2004, and is a former Chair of the International Society for the Performing Arts Foundation in the United States.
